Reducing Diesel Dependence.
Battery Energy Storage Systems (BESS) deliver the instant power needed for heavy lifts while allowing generators to operate at their most efficient load—or remain off when not required. The result is reliable crane and hoist performance, lower operating costs, quieter construction sites, and a substantial reduction in diesel consumption and carbon emissions.
Build Sooner | Lift Bigger
Sites that would traditionally be limited by available utility power can deploy larger tower cranes and construction hoists much earlier in the project lifecycle. Instead of downsizing equipment, delaying mobilization, or waiting for costly utility upgrades, contractors can move forward with the equipment they need from day one. The result is faster project starts, greater site flexibility, and fewer power-related constraints on productivity. Battery Energy Storage Systems don’t just improve efficiency—they unlock new project possibilities.
The Crane Power Transition
New construction grade Bess battery power units like the AMPD Enertainer are engineered specifically to handle the sudden, violent inductive motor starting currents unique to tower cranes without voltage sags or tripping breakers.
Digital Power for Tower Cranes
Space on downtown construction sites in Vancouver, Calgary, or Kelowna is non-existent. The battery power container like AMPD Enertainer 400 delivers massive peak output from a highly compact footprint—significantly smaller than standard ISO container dimensions—allowing it to easily fit into tight staging areas, narrow laneways, or loading bays.
